Kyocera Qua Phone QZ

Kyocera Qua Phone QZ is a smartphone with the embodiment of uniqueness launched recently to meet up with the users’ needs. The smartphone was officially released on 15 January 2018 with a cost-related price of about NGN105,000 in Nigeria.

The Kyocera Qua Phone QZ runs on Android Operating System version v8.0 serial of Oreo and is powered by  Snapdragon 430 chipset based on Cortex Octa-core 1.4 GHz Cortex-A53 processor.

The smartphone comes with a 5 inches display touchscreen with IPS technology LCD. It as well has a screen resolution of 1080 x 1920 pixels with 294 PPI pixels density. Meanwhile, when it comes to dimensions, the device measures 145mm height 72mm width 8.7mm thickness and it has a weight of 136 grams.

Kyocera Qua Phone QZ is fueled by a Lithium-Ion 2600 mAh non-removable battery capacity that is capable of providing talk time of about 24 hours, Music playtime 130 hours, and 6 hours of video watching. The device user can do other daily tasks confidently with the device battery such as web browsing, playing android games, etc.

The smartphone packs 3 GB of RAM that offers immersive gaming and also gives heavy device users a proper edge to do their activities without the device hanging. While it comes with 32 GB of internal storage with External Memory Support of Up to 128GB.

As far as the cameras are concerned, the smartphone packs 13 MP, 4120 x 3096 pixels Camera optical image stabilization, ing, with features such as touch focus, face detection, panorama, HDR autofocus, LED flash, 2160p@30fps, 1080p@30fps for video recording, optical stabilization, stereo sound rec. While on the front, it carries 5MP, 1080p@30fps for selfies.

Connectivity options of Kyocera Qua Phone QZ include  Wi-Fi 802.11 a/b/g/n/ac, Bluetooth v4.2, A2DP, USB v2.0, dual-band, Wi-Fi Direct, DLNA, Wi-Fi hotspot. However, the smartphone comes with sensors such as Proximity Sensor, Accelerometer, Light Sensor.

Kyocera Qua Phone QZ – Full Specifications

Here is a well detailed/analyzed Kyocera Qua Phone QZ specifications as well as the features embedded in this smartphone:

PLATFORM

  • OS: Android 8.0 Oreo
  • Chipset: Qualcomm Snapdragon 430 MSM8937
  • CPU:  Octa-Core 4×1.4GHz Cortex-A53+ 4×1.1GHz Cortex-A53
  • GPU: Qualcomm Adreno 505

NETWORK

  • Technology: GSM / HSPA / LTE
  • 2G bands: GSM 850 / 900 / 1800 / 1900,
  • 3G bands: HSDPA 850 / 900 / 1700 / 1900 / 2100
  • 4G bands: LTE 700 / 800 / 1700 / 1800 / 2600,
  • Speed: HSDPA, 42 Mbps; HSUPA, 5.8 Mbps; LTE, Cat4, 50 Mbps UL, 150 Mbps DL,
  • EDGE: up to 296 KB per second,
  • GPPS: up to 107 KB per second Nano SIM

DISPLAY

  • Type: TFT capacitive touchscreen
  • Size: 5.0 inches
  • Resolution: 1080×1920 Pixels, 24-bit color depth
  • Display Colors: 16M Colors
  • Pixel Density: ~ 441 PPI
  • Touch Screen: Yes Multi-Touch Support
  • Display Protection: Yes
  • Features: FHD Display
    ~ 441 PPI
    Capacitive
    Multi-touch
    Scratch Resistant
    Dragontrail Glass

BATTERY

  • Type: Lithium-Ion, Non-removable
  • Capacity: 2,600 mAh
  • Standby time: 402 Hours
  • Music Play: Up to 54 hours
  • Talk time: Up to 24 Hours

FEATURES

  • Sensors: Proximity Sensor, Accelerometer, Light Sensor

BODY

  • Type: Bar
  • Dimensions: 145 mm x 72 mm x 8.7 mm
  • Weight: 136 Grams (with battery)
  • Body material: Metal, Plastic
  • Waterproof: No

MEMORY

  • RAM (Memory): 3 GB
  • Internal Storage: 32 GB
  • Memory Card Slot: External Memory Support Up to 128GB

SOUND

  • Loudspeaker: Yes
  • 3.5mm Jack: Yes

CAMERA

  • Rear Camera: 13 Megapixels
  • Image: 4160 x 3120 Pixels
  • Video: 1080p@30fps
  • Flash: Yes with Single-LED Flash
  • Front Camera: 5 Megapixels

COMMONS

  • WLAN: Wi-Fi 802.11 b/g/n, Wi-Fi Direct, Wi-Fi Hotspot
  • USB: Type-C USBv2.0, With OTG, Charging and Mass Storage Function
  • GPS: Yes, with A-GPS, GPS
  • NFC: Yes
  • Radio: No

MISC

  • Colors: Smart White, Vibrant Yellow, Dream Green, Cool Blue, and Space Grey
